Hello,
kernel test robot noticed a 13.5% regression of stress-ng.timerfd.ops_per_sec on:
commit: ed30c4adfc2b56909ca43fb5e4750a646928cbf4 ("slab: add optimized sheaf refill from partial list")
https://git.kernel.org/cgit/linux/kernel/git/torvalds/linux.git master
[still regression on linus/master a95f71ad3e2e224277508e006580c333d0a5fe36]
[still regression on linux-next/master d4906ae14a5f136ceb671bb14cedbf13fa560da6]
testcase: stress-ng
config: x86_64-rhel-9.4
compiler: gcc-14
test machine: 224 threads 2 sockets Intel(R) Xeon(R) Platinum 8480CTDX (Sapphire Rapids) with 512G memory
parameters:
nr_threads: 100%
testtime: 60s
test: timerfd
cpufreq_governor: performance
